php連接mysql數(shù)據(jù)庫代碼(php連接mysql數(shù)據(jù)庫需要用到的三個(gè)參數(shù)分別是)
mima=quotquot 數(shù)據(jù)庫密碼 mysql_queryquotSET NAME #39GB2312#39quot 這個(gè)是強(qiáng)制編碼,如果你的php是utf8的就寫utf8 如果是gbk的不管 你可以再mysql_queryquotSET NAME ‘GB2312’quot下面加入 echo quot連接成功quot 如果出現(xiàn)這個(gè),證明連接成功了當(dāng)然,如果你不加,直接運(yùn)行上面的連接頁面;PHP 可以使用 MySQLi 或 PDOPHP Data Objects擴(kuò)展來連接 MySQL 數(shù)據(jù)庫以下是使用 MySQLi 擴(kuò)展連接 MySQL 數(shù)據(jù)庫的示例代碼mysqli pdo 請(qǐng)注意,您需要替換 hostname,username,password 和 database_name 為自己的數(shù)據(jù)庫連接詳細(xì)信息。
首先,我們需要使用mysql_connect函數(shù)連接到MySQL服務(wù)器在連接時(shí),我們提供了本地主機(jī)名用戶名和密碼如果連接失敗,程序?qū)⑤敵鲆粭l錯(cuò)誤信息具體代碼如下conn = @mysql_connectquotlocalhostquot,quotrootquot,quotquot or diequot數(shù)據(jù)庫連接失敗quotmysql_error接下來,我們需要選擇一個(gè)數(shù)據(jù)庫這里我;php連接數(shù)據(jù)庫有兩種方式1面向?qū)ο蠓绞?conn=new mysqli#39服務(wù)器名#39,#39用戶名#39,#39密碼#39,#39數(shù)據(jù)庫名#392面向過程方式 conn=mysqli_connet#39服務(wù)器名#39,#39用戶名#39,#39密碼#39,#39數(shù)據(jù)庫名#39如果在連接的時(shí)候沒有指定要連接的數(shù)據(jù)庫,可以用兩種方式選擇你要連接的數(shù)據(jù)庫1面向?qū)ο蠓绞?conn。
鼠標(biāo)右鍵我的電腦管理服務(wù)和應(yīng)用程序服務(wù)找到mysql服務(wù),看看是不是啟用狀態(tài)也可以打開運(yùn)行,輸入 mysql u root用戶名 p 密碼看看能不能打開客戶端3如果上面的可以了,那么就進(jìn)入正題了,php連接mysql代碼實(shí)例 4最后運(yùn)行這個(gè)文件,看看運(yùn)行結(jié)果吧。
php連接mysql數(shù)據(jù)庫需要用到的三個(gè)參數(shù)分別是
1、conn = mysql_connect$hostname, $username, $password or diequot不能連接服務(wù)器!quotmysql_select_dbquot$dbnamequot, $conn or diequot不能選擇數(shù)據(jù)庫quot為了確保代碼正確執(zhí)行,需要確認(rèn)以下幾點(diǎn)1 確認(rèn)數(shù)據(jù)庫服務(wù)器是否正常運(yùn)行2 確認(rèn)提供的數(shù)據(jù)庫用戶名和密碼是否準(zhǔn)確3 確認(rèn)用戶是否具有。
2、在開始之前,請(qǐng)確保你已經(jīng)安裝了PHP和MySQL,并且能夠通過PHP連接到MySQL數(shù)據(jù)庫首先,我們需要?jiǎng)?chuàng)建一個(gè)名為diaochaphp的文件,用于接收HTML表單提交的數(shù)據(jù)具體代碼如下radiogroup = isset$_POST#39radiogroup#39?$radiogroup#39#39這段代碼的作用是檢查表單中的radiogroup是否已被選中提交如果存在。
3、已安裝mysql數(shù)據(jù)庫檢查php環(huán)境是否已開啟mysql擴(kuò)展一般情況下是開啟的檢查方法a使用phpinfo函數(shù),看有沒有mysql項(xiàng)b打開phpini文件,檢查php_mysqldll前分號(hào)是否已取掉php鏈接代碼如下4。
4、語法格式mysql_exec$conn, $sql其中,$conn是連接到MySQL數(shù)據(jù)庫的標(biāo)識(shí)符,$sql是要執(zhí)行的SQL語句返回值執(zhí)行成功返回TRUE,執(zhí)行失敗返回FALSE下面我們來詳細(xì)介紹一下mysql_exec函數(shù)的使用方法1建立MySQL連接 我們需要建立一個(gè)到MySQL數(shù)據(jù)庫的連接這可以通過mysql_connect函數(shù)實(shí)現(xiàn) 代碼如。
5、以下是一個(gè)簡(jiǎn)要的PHP調(diào)用MySQL函數(shù)的代碼示例php lt?php retval = mysqli_connect$connect 連接數(shù)據(jù)庫 if !$retval die#39相關(guān)錯(cuò)誤信息#39 處理連接失敗情況 接下來的代碼將執(zhí)行SQL語句并處理結(jié)果 ? 通過學(xué)習(xí)更多的MySQL功能函數(shù),開發(fā)者可以更高效地利用PHP與。
6、255 UNSIGNED NOT NULL AUTO_INCREMENT ,`count` INT255 UNSIGNED NOT NULL DEFAULT 0,PRIMARY KEY `id` TYPE = innodb#39mysql_select_db$mysql_database,$connresult=mysql_query$sqlecho $sqlmysql_close$connecho quotHello!數(shù)據(jù)庫mycounter已經(jīng)成功建立quot。
7、連接MySQL的代碼dsn=#39mysqlhost=#39$dbhost#39dbname=#39$dbdatabase#39#39 $dbh=new PDO$dsn,$username,$userpassSQLite3dsn=#39sqlite3quotD\sqlite\userdbquot#39dbh=new PDO$dsnPostgreSQLdsn=#39pgsqlhost=#39$dbhost#39 port=5432 dbname=#39$dbdatabase#39 user=#39$username。
php連接mysql數(shù)據(jù)庫的幾種方式及區(qū)別
lt?php$conn=mysql_connectquotquot,quot數(shù)據(jù)庫賬號(hào)quot,quot數(shù)據(jù)庫密碼quotmysql_select_dbquot數(shù)據(jù)庫名稱quot, $conn$result = mysql_queryquotselect versionquotwhile$row = mysql_fetch_array$result print_r$row echo #39數(shù)據(jù)庫版本是#39$row#39version#39 mysql_。
安裝完成后再使用PHP連接mysql,代碼操作步驟如下下載php_mysqldll擴(kuò)展,放到ext文件夾下,如果存在則跳過打開phpini配置文件,去掉extension=php_mysqldll項(xiàng)前面的分號(hào),如果已取掉則跳過此步驟然后運(yùn)行phpinfo如果存在mysql項(xiàng),則說明已經(jīng)開啟mysql擴(kuò)展php連接mysql數(shù)據(jù)庫操作運(yùn)行結(jié)果。
當(dāng)用戶提交表單后,數(shù)據(jù)會(huì)被發(fā)送到`searchphp`文件進(jìn)行處理在`searchphp`文件中,需要連接數(shù)據(jù)庫并執(zhí)行查詢操作以下是一個(gè)基本的代碼示例lt?php servername = quotlocalhostquotusername = quotusernamequotpassword = quotpasswordquotdbname = quotdatabase_namequot 創(chuàng)建連接 conn = new mysqli$server。
query = quotCREATE DATABASE $databasequotresult = mysql_query$querymysql_select_db$database,$connor die $couldNotOpenDatabase 以上代碼中,首先定義了用戶等級(jí)數(shù)組,然后通過mysql_connect連接到MySQL服務(wù)器,如果連接失敗則直接終止程序如果數(shù)據(jù)庫已存在,則直接選擇該數(shù)據(jù)庫如果。
掃描二維碼推送至手機(jī)訪問。
版權(quán)聲明:本文由飛速云SEO網(wǎng)絡(luò)優(yōu)化推廣發(fā)布,如需轉(zhuǎn)載請(qǐng)注明出處。